1. This is the inflammation of the heart's inner lining, usually caused by an infection.

Correct answer: A

Rationale: Endocarditis is the inflammation of the inner lining of the heart's chambers and valves, usually caused by a bacterial infection. Myocarditis is the inflammation of the heart muscle, Pericarditis is the inflammation of the pericardium (the outer lining of the heart), and Valvulitis is the inflammation of the heart valves. Therefore, in this case, the correct answer is Endocarditis as it specifically refers to the inflammation of the heart's inner lining.

2. What is the term for a condition where the lung collapses due to air leaking into the space between the lung and the chest wall?

Correct answer: A

Rationale: Pneumothorax is the correct answer for this question. Pneumothorax is the collapse of a lung caused by the presence of air in the pleural space between the lung and chest wall. This condition can lead to chest pain, shortness of breath, and may require emergency treatment such as chest tube insertion to remove the air. Pleural effusion is the accumulation of fluid in the pleural space, not air. Atelectasis is the collapse or closure of a lung resulting in reduced or absent gas exchange. Pulmonary fibrosis is a condition characterized by scarring and thickening of lung tissue, not related to air leaking into the pleural space.

3. What is a condition where the blood pressure in the arteries is consistently too high, increasing the risk of heart disease and stroke?

Correct answer: A

Rationale: Hypertension, also known as high blood pressure, is a condition where the force of the blood against the artery walls is consistently too high. This increased pressure can lead to serious health issues such as heart disease and stroke. Hypotension (choice B) refers to low blood pressure, which is not the correct term in this context. Diabetes (choice C) and hyperlipidemia (choice D) are also serious conditions but are not specifically characterized by consistently high blood pressure.

5. The client on spironolactone (Aldactone) has a potassium level of 5.6 mEq/L. What is the nurse’s priority action?

Correct answer: A

Rationale: The correct answer is A: Hold the spironolactone and notify the healthcare provider. A potassium level of 5.6 mEq/L is high, indicating hyperkalemia. Spironolactone is a potassium-sparing diuretic that can further elevate potassium levels. Therefore, the priority action is to withhold the medication to prevent exacerbating hyperkalemia and notify the healthcare provider for further management. Option B is incorrect because administering potassium supplements would worsen the hyperkalemia. Option C is incorrect as continuing spironolactone can lead to a further increase in potassium levels. Option D is incorrect as increasing the dose of spironolactone would be inappropriate in the presence of elevated potassium levels.
